One of the most substantial developments in getting a medical license online is the Federation Credentials Verification Service (FCVS), managed by the Federation of State Medical Boards (FSMB).
FCVS acts as a permanent, central repository for a doctor's primary source-verified qualifications. Instead of a candidate having to call their medical school and residency programs every time they obtain a new state license, they can utilize FCVS to send out a "qualifications package" electronically to any getting involved state board.
Advantages of using FCVS include:

For physicians aiming to practice in multiple states, particularly those associated with telehealth, the Interstate Medical Licensure Compact (IMLC) is an advanced online tool. The IMLC is a contract between participating U.S. states and territories to simplify the licensing process for physicians who desire to practice in several jurisdictions.
Under this system, a physician designates a "State of Principal Licensure" (SPL). When the SPL confirms the physician's eligibility, the practitioner can request licenses in other member states through a single online portal. The licenses are often released within a matter of days or weeks, rather than months.

Navigating the online application procedure requires organization and attention to information. A lot of state boards follow a similar digital workflow.
1. Verification of Eligibility
Before start, the candidate should review the specific requirements of the state medical board where they look for licensure. Some states need more years of postgraduate training than others, and some have specific "look-back" periods for clinical practice.
2. Production of a Professional Profile
Candidates generally begin by developing an account on the state board's website or the FSMB's Uniform Application (UA) platform. The UA is a one-stop store used by dozens of state boards to collect market and academic information.
3. Submission of Primary Source Verifications
The applicant should ensure that 3rd parties (medical schools, healthcare facilities, screening companies) send out digital confirmations straight to the board.

While the application is online, numerous states still require "damp ink" or digital fingerprints for a criminal background check. Some states use services like Identogo, which enables candidates to schedule fingerprinting visits online and has the outcomes sent out digitally to the medical board.
5. Last Review and Fees
The last step includes a digital signature and the payment of licensing fees through charge card or electronic check. Charges vary widely by state, varying from ₤ 300 to over ₤ 1,000.
Licensing for Telehealth and Digital Medicine
The rise of telehealth has popularized the concept of the "online medical license." To treat a client located in a various state, a physician needs to normally be licensed in the state where the client lies at the time of the encounter.
To facilitate this, numerous states have actually introduced:

For how long does the online licensing procedure take?
The timeline varies. Utilizing the IMLC can take just 2 weeks. A standard online application typically takes between 60 and 120 days, depending on how quickly third-party confirmations are gotten.
Is an online medical license valid for prescribing medication?
Yes. A medical license gotten by means of an online application process is a standard professional license. Nevertheless, to recommend regulated substances, the physician must also look for a DEA (Drug Enforcement Administration) registration, which is likewise an online process.
What is the "Uniform Application"?
The Uniform Application (UA) is a service supplied by the FSMB that enables physicians to complete a single core application that can be sent out to multiple taking part state boards, lowering the requirement to re-type the same info.
What occurs if my application is rejected?
If an online application is flagged due to missing out on details or eligibility issues, the board will normally alert the applicant through an online portal or e-mail. The majority of boards permit a duration for the applicant to correct the shortage or appeal the choice.
